You can use Bluetooth to transfer files to your Mac. Using a USB cable won't work since for some weird reason the phone doesn't show up as USB drive on a Mac and the tool provided by Microsoft is a joke, to say the least. Download the Files app from the Store, then "share" the file and select Bluetooth as destination. Obviously you have to enable bluetooth file sharing on your Mac first and pair the devices. Works like a charm for me.
